The SANTE Tool: Value Analysis, Program Slicing and Test Generation for C Program Debugging

Abstract

This short paper presents a prototype tool called SANTE (Static ANalysis and TEsting) implementing an original method combining value analysis, program slicing and structural test generation for verification of C programs. First, value analysis is called to generate alarms when it can not guarantee the absence of errors. Then the program is reduced by program slicing. Alarm-guided test generation is then used to analyze the simplified program(s) in order to confirm or reject alarms.
